Override Request Process
A student may need an override to get into a class for either of two reasons: (1) the class is closed or (2) the student does not satisfy the prerequisite as it is entered in the registration system.
- Closed (filled) classes
During the early enrollment period, students should request an override by sending an email message to Prof. Fox at foxcj@jmu.edu. After that, students should contact the course's instructor. - Waiving prerequisites
Students that want to waive a prerequisite should contact the course's instructor. Normally, prerequisites are NOT waived except for exceptional circumstances.
